分布式opentelemetry基础知识 架构
Java-基础篇
1:Java背景知识 Java是美国 sun 公司(Stanford University Network)在1995年推出的一门计算机高级编程语言。 Java 早期称为Oak(橡树),后期改名为Java。 Java 之父:詹姆斯·高斯林(James Gosling)。 2009年 sun公司被Or ......
git基础
安装 sudo apt update sudo apt install git 配置 git config --global user.name "名称" git congig --global user.email "邮箱" 生成ssh key ssh-keygen -t rsa -C "邮箱" ......
【IT老齐004】多级缓存架构
【IT老齐004】多级缓存架构 客户端、应用层、服务层、数据层 客户端缓存 主要对浏览器的静态资源进行缓存 通过在浏览器设置Expires或者Cache-control,时间段内以文件形式把图片保存在本地,减少多次请求静态资源带来的带宽损耗(解决并发手段) 浏览器只负责读取Expires或者Cach ......
gradle基础知识
帮助命令 :gradle --help 查看版本: gradle -v 清空所有编译: gradle clean 构建:gradle build 跳过测试构建构建: gradle build -x test 第三⽅插件 https://plugins.gradle.org/ 核⼼插件 https:/ ......
第五讲 Weldentity分布式身份解决方案、智能合约初探
#什么是智能合约 1996年,Nick Szabo在文章《Smart Contracts:Building Blocks For Digital Markets》中提出了智能合约的概念 所谓“合约”,就是条文、合同一类的东西,里面记录了发生的条件与对应执行的条款,以支持确权等操作;所谓”智能”,就意 ......
kubernetes集群的高可用架构
概述 kubernete在云平台的高可用分为两种情形 单az的高可用集群搭建 多az的高可用集群搭建 这两种情形其实就是一个k8s集群内部的高可用,只是多az的场景下能够实现更高级别的高可用,此时k8s需要跨az部署集群。 集群内部的高可用需要实现基础组件的高可用,其中最重要的就是etcd和apis ......
前端入门知识
1 关于 tpl 格式文件 以前的前端页面都是.html格式的,现在出现了.tpl文件,是template的缩写,发现他就是前端页面,写的也是html。 应该是前端模板Smarty的一个格式。可以在Dreamviewer中打开,进行可视化编辑。应该也可以使用PS打开。 ......
JavaScript 基础问答
JavaScript数据类型有哪几种? 一共有五种:number、string、object、boolean、undefined.其中最后一个是定义变量后没有赋值 介绍隐式类型转换 字符串+数字=字符串;字符串-数字=数字;+数字字符串=数字 null 经过数字转换之后会变为 0 undefined ......
常用架构模型
分层架构(Layered Architecture) 最常见的软件架构。这种架构将软件分成若干个水平层,每一层都有清晰的角色和分工,不需要知道其它层的细节。层与层之间通过接口进行通信。 最常见的是四层结构: 表现层(Presentation Layer):用户界面,负责视觉和用户互动 业务层(Bus ......
k8s架构组件说明
架构图组件实况图组件:k8s的node每个都有两个程序组件:kubelet和kube-proxy。kubelet在nonde上充当一个agent的作用。kube-proxy是负责对外访问的网络。k8s的master的组件详细说明:apiserver主要是集群入口和调度etcd:把全部连接信息等都会存 ......
软件的基础知识
1.键盘和快捷键 Ctrl+a 全选 Ctrl+c 复制 Ctrl+x 剪切 Ctrl+v 粘贴 Ctrl+s 保存 Ctrl+z 回退 win+r 运行 输入cmd命令行工具 2.计算器 Windows自带的计算器,左上角有程序员计算方式 3.文件和文件夹的常用命名 •demo文件夹:案例 •te ......
Django4全栈进阶之路14 template模板的基础模板
在 Django 中,我们可以使用模板继承来避免代码的重复。模板继承是指我们可以在一个模板中定义一些公共的 HTML 代码,然后在其他模板中继承这个基础模板,并根据需要添加或覆盖一些内容。 通常情况下,我们会定义一个名为 base.html 的基础模板,其中包含网站的公共结构和样式,例如页眉、页脚、 ......
redis实现分布式锁
分布式锁是由共享存储系统维护的变量,多个客户端可以向共享存储系统发送命令进行加 锁或释放锁操作。Redis 作为一个共享存储系统,可以用来实现分布式锁。 在基于单个 Redis 实例实现分布式锁时,对于加锁操作,我们需要满足三个条件。 条件一:客户端从超过半数(大于等于 N/2+1)的 Redis ......
.net使用nacos配置,手把手教你分布式配置中心
.net使用nacos配置,手把手教你分布式配置中心 Nacos是一个更易于构建云原生应用的动态服务发现、配置管理和服务管理平台。 这么优秀的分布式服务管理平台,怎么能不接入呢? nacos的安装和使用这里就不细说了,可以参考网上教程和官方文档。https://nacos.io/zh-cn/docs ......
.NET CORE开源 DDD微服务 支持 多租户 单点登录 多级缓存、自动任务、分布式、日志、授权和鉴权 、网关 、注册与发现 系统架构 docker部署
源代码地址https://github.com/junkai-li/NetCoreKevin基于NET6搭建跨平台DDD思想WebApi架构、IDS4单点登录、多缓存、自动任务、分布式、多租户、日志、授权和鉴权、CAP、SignalR、 docker部署 如需简约项目可直接去除项目引用 解耦设计都可 ......
Raft 共识算法1-Raft基础
Raft 通过首先选举一个领导者来实现共识,然后让领导者完全负责管理复制的日志。 领导者接受来自客户端的日志条目,将它们复制到其他服务器上,并告诉服务器何时可以安全地将日志条目应用到它们的状态机。 拥有领导者可以简化复制日志的管理。 例如,领导者可以在不咨询其他服务器的情况下决定在日志中放置新条目的... ......
c/c++零基础坐牢第七天
c/c++从入门到入土(7) 开始时间:2023-04-23 23:06:22 结束时间:2023-04-24 00:41:25 前言:今天的调休生活过得怎么样呢,哈哈哈哈。蓝桥杯省赛成绩出来了,大家是不是像我一样的省四呢?咳咳,早知道今年的国赛在北京比,我肯定会拆掉那台电脑吧!初学者,咱们多练习练 ......
Wallis 公式、Stirling 公式与正态分布
参考: 张筑生《数学分析新讲》第二册[1] 张颢《概率论》[2] Wikipedia, Math StackExchange, etc. 1 Warm up Example 1 求 limn→∞(2n−1)!!(2n)!!=limn→∞1×3×5×⋯×(2n−1)2×4×6×⋯×2n Solutio ......
docker基础
一、Docker概述 1. Docker是什么 Docker是一个开源的应用容器引擎,基于go语言开发并遵循了apache2.0协议开源。Docker是在Linux容器里运行应用的开源工具,是一种轻量级的“虚拟机”。Docker 的容器技术可以在一台主机上轻松为任何应用创建一个轻量级的、可移植的、自 ......
深度学习--卷积神经网络基础
深度学习--卷积神经网络基础 1.卷积操作 卷积操作简单来说就是矩阵对应位置相乘求和,这样不仅可以减少模型的参数数量,还可以关注到图像的局部相关特性。 import torch import torch.nn as nn import torch.nn.functional as F #卷积操作(I ......
六、利用代码生成器快速实现火车基础数据的维护
内容 完成火车基础数据管理功能:车站(车站的名称或首字母可以搜索)、车次(高铁、动车等)、车厢(车厢种类和座位数)、座位(座位类型)。 项目中增加admin控台模块 后台管理不会有注册,一般由初始管理员分配 9.3 创建admin模块,所有的代码都是从web复制 接口改为9001 admin去掉登录 ......
计算机网络基础——08 DNS 服务器的配置和应用
8.1实验目的 了解 DNS 的有关概念和常见的 DNS 服务器 掌握 Windows 2003 的 DNS 服务器的安装与配置 掌握客户端的设置和验证 8.2实验相关知识 8.2.1DNS 的概念 DNS 的定义 DNS 是域名系统(Domain Name System)的缩写,是将域名翻译成 I ......
Halcon基础学习(一)
Halcon基础学习(一) 初见 目标: 提取出U4的位置坐标 结果: 编程逻辑 读取图片 按照RGB3通道处理图片 使用中值滤波 使用灰度滤波 使用二值化滤波 组件区域分割 使用特征直方图设置上下限 直到过滤到唯一一个以后,使用区域选择工具 在新打开的图片上面绘制十字叉 编程实现 read_ima ......
java架构师视频教程
我真的希望大家能坚持学完我的这套java架构师视频教程,我知道这的确要花费很多的时间和精力,还有大量的练习,我在开始学习的时候也和大家一样的厌倦学习,中途想要放弃。 但想想看,既然知道我的这套java架构师的确是非常有效果的,并能改变我们的技术能力,让我们在工作中一生受益,那为什么不坚持下去呢,难道 ......
基础题:百钱买百鸡(延伸题)
有30人,可能包括男人、女人、小孩,他们在一饭店共消费50先令,其中每个男人花3先令, 每个女人花2先令,每个小孩花1先令,求男人、女人、小孩各多少人? (此题就是换了个名词的百钱买百鸡) 这是个基础题,但是我经常学到后面忘记前面这种需要带点脑子的基础题,所以写做了一期笔记。 我总结了两个方法:方法 ......
redis 做分布式限流
参看来源: https://blog.51cto.com/u_15708799/5703440 测试有效代码: @Test public void testLimitWait() throws InterruptedException { ExecutorService pool = Executo ......
大数据架构(二)大数据发展史
1.传统数仓发展史 传统数据仓库的发展史这里不展开架构细讲,只需快速过一遍即可。了解这个历史发展过程即可。 1.1 传统数仓历史 1.1.1 5个时代 传统数仓发展史可以称为5个时代的经典论证战。按照两位数据仓库大师 Ralph kilmball、Bill Innmon 在数据仓库建设理念上碰撞阶段 ......
docker容器基础
一、Docker 概述 1、Docker的概念 Docker是一个开源的应用容器引擎,基于go语言开发并遵循了apache2.0协议开源 Docker是在Linux容器里运行应用的开源工具,是一种轻量级的“虚拟机” Docker 的容器技术可以在一台主机上轻松为任何应用创建一个轻量级的、可移植的、自 ......
当⻉借⼒阿⾥云落地云原⽣架构转型,运维降本、效率稳定性双升
随着业务飞速发展,当贝的传统 IT 资产也渐显臃肿,为了避免制约发展的瓶颈,痛定思痛,技术团队果断变革:核心业务云原生化之后,运维效率、整体稳定性和研发效率均得到了全面提升。
本文主要简述当贝技术团队云原生之路的背景诉求、落地方法和收获成果。 ......